Description

Rat anti-mouse interleukin 6 antibody, recognizes murine interleukin 6 (IL-6). IL-6 is an effective lymphoid cell growth factor, mainly expressed by macrophages and T cells.

Storage

Store at +4°C or at -20°C if preferred. Storage in frost-free freezers is not recommended. This product should be stored undiluted. Avoid repeated freezing and thawing as this may denature the antibody. Should this product contain a precipitate we recommend micr°Centrifugation before use.
